Trang An vs Tam Coc Cycling: Overview

Before diving deeper, here is a general comparison of cycling in both areas.

Cycling in Tam Coc

Tam Coc is known for wide-open rice fields, peaceful countryside, gentle village paths, and flat, easy cycling routes. It’s perfect for slow travel, photography, and beginners.

Cycling in Trang An

Trang An offers shaded forest paths, winding mountain corridors, and more adventurous terrain. It is slightly more challenging than Tam Coc but extremely rewarding.

Key Differences

Tam Coc = rice fields + villages + accessible scenic routes
Trang An = forest roads + towering karsts + nature-focused routes

Both are spectacular in their own way.

Scenery Comparison: Trang An vs Tam Coc Cycling

Scenery in Tam Coc

Tam Coc is famous for:

  • Endless rice fields

  • Purple and pink lotus ponds

  • Farmers working in the fields

  • Water buffalo wandering slowly

  • Quiet rural villages

  • Boat riders on the Ngo Dong River

The scenery feels open, warm, and filled with life.

Scenery in Trang An

Trang An is known for:

  • Dense jungle landscapes

  • Towering limestone cliffs

  • River valleys surrounded by forests

  • Temples and shrines hidden in caves

  • Shaded cycling paths

Trang An feels more dramatic, lush, and mysterious.

Which One Has the Best Views?

For rice field lovers: Tam Coc
For forest and mountain lovers: Trang An
For photographers: Both are exceptional

Terrain Comparison: Flat or Challenging?

Tam Coc Terrain

Tam Coc roads are known for being:

  • Flat

  • Easy

  • Wide

  • Beginner-friendly

Cycling here feels relaxing and effortless.

Trang An Terrain

Trang An roads include:

  • Slight inclines and gentle curves

  • Forested roads with shade

  • Narrow paths in some areas

  • Long loops around valleys

Still easy overall, but more varied.

Which Is Easier?

Tam Coc is the easiest and safest choice for travelers of all levels.
Trang An is still manageable but better for those who enjoy a bit more variety.

Best Cycling Routes in Tam Coc

Below are the most beautiful routes you can explore.

Tam Coc Rice Field Loop

Distance: 3–4 km
Difficulty: Very easy
What you see: golden rice fields, lotus ponds, buffalo

Tam Coc to Bich Dong Pagoda

Distance: 3 km
Difficulty: Easy
Highlights: historic pagoda, mountain caves, lotus lakes

Tam Coc to Mua Cave

Distance: 4–5 km
Difficulty: Easy
Highlights: mountain valley, lotus lake, dragon viewpoint

Tam Coc to Trang An

Distance: 6–8 km
Difficulty: Easy to moderate
Highlights: rivers, cliffs, shaded areas

All routes in Tam Coc are flat, scenic, and suitable for beginners.

Best Cycling Routes in Trang An

Trang An offers slightly more diverse landscapes.

Trang An Scenic Loop

Distance: 7–9 km
Difficulty: Moderate
Highlights: jungle hills, rivers, temples

Trang An to Hoa Lu Ancient Capital

Distance: 3–4 km
Difficulty: Easy
Highlights: ancient temples, cultural sites

Trang An to Bai Dinh Pagoda

Distance: 10–12 km
Difficulty: Moderate
Highlights: the largest pagoda complex in Vietnam

Trang An to Mua Cave

Distance: 7–8 km
Difficulty: Moderate
Highlights: forest roads + valley scenery

Trang An routes are beautiful but more varied in shape and elevation.

Best Time for Cycling: Trang An vs Tam Coc

Best Season

February – April (spring)
May – June (golden rice season in Tam Coc)
September – November (cool autumn weather)

Best Time of Day

Early morning
Late afternoon (golden hour)

These periods offer cooler temperatures and stunning scenery.

Bicycle Rental Options

Standard Bike: 40,000–80,000 VND
Mountain Bike: 100,000–150,000 VND
Hybrid Premium Bike: 150,000–250,000 VND
E-Bike: 250,000–350,000 VND

Quality varies widely.

One-Day Itinerary: Tam Coc Cycling Experience

Morning
Cycle the rice field loop
Visit Bich Dong Pagoda

Lunch
Local restaurant in Tam Coc

Afternoon
Cycle to Mua Cave
Climb to dragon viewpoint

Evening
Ride through the rice fields at sunset

One-Day Itinerary: Trang An Cycling Experience

Morning
Trang An scenic loop
Visit temples and shrines

Lunch
Local Gia Sinh or Trang An restaurant

Afternoon
Cycle to Hoa Lu Ancient Capital

Evening
Ride back through forest pathways

Two-Day Combined Cycling Itinerary: Best of Both Worlds

Day 1 (Tam Coc)
Rice fields + Bich Dong + Mua Cave

Day 2 (Trang An)
Trang An loop + Hoa Lu + optional Bai Dinh

This combined itinerary gives you the best of both cycling worlds.
